Noun: hooknose 'hûk,nowz
- A nose with a prominent slightly aquiline bridge
"The actor's distinctive hooknose gave him a noble profile";
- Roman nose
Derived forms: hooknoses
Type of: beak [informal], conk [Brit, informal], honker [informal], hooter [informal], nose, nozzle [informal], olfactory organ, schnoz [informal], schnozzle [informal], snoot [informal], snout [informal]
